Job description
Assembles aircraft interior structures and / or parts, such as bins, galleys, lavatories, sidewalls, cargo liners, etc. and builds sub-assemblies for the completion of aircraft interior structures, and / or parts using engineering drawings, company and customer specifications.
Adheres to company and customer specifications, work instructions, engineering prints & work orders.
Document materials used in each process to maintain traceability.
All employees are required to productively react to change and handle other essential tasks as assigned now or in the future. May work at different workstations as production needs require.
Builds sub-assemblies of aircraft components, such as :
1.- Forming of aluminum trim extrusions, fiberglass laminates and other materials for completion of the sub-assemblies, parts or structures.
2.- Fills and fairs areas as necessary per the established specification or customer limits.
3.-Installs inserts and applies edging material.
4.- Assembles sub components for the structures / units.
Cleans work area, machines, tools, and equipment during and after production.
